Good morning Hayden, As you know we made another site visit to 1006 Wyoming St.
Our concerns were not with any of the cosmetic aspects of the home but rather its
structural elements. During our visit there was no question that the floors were not
level, doors and windows were misaligned not properly functioning, there was some
plumbing separation that had occurred, and last but not least there was obvious signs of
twisting and bending of framing members. These are all indications of severe
foundation failure. With this being said, I would recommend completely re-leveling the
home to re-establish the homes stability and structural integrity. Please let us know your
thoughts and intent for resolving these particular issues? Thanks Gregory
